Apte Sanskrit-English Dictionary

[menakāyāṃ bhavaḥ aṇ] N. of a mountain, son of Himālaya and Menā, who alone retained his wings (when Indra clipped those of other mountains) on account of his friendship with the ocean; cf. Ku. 1. 20. Comp. svasṛ f. an epithet of Pārvatī.
